Step 2: Water Extraction and Drying

Our team will use specialized equipment, including wet/dry vacuums and desiccant dehumidifiers, to extract the water from the affected areas. We’ll also use high-velocity air movers to speed up the drying process and prevent mold growth. We’ll monitor the process to ensure it’s working efficiently and effectively.

Structural Drying Services Cost In Fresno, TX

The cost of structural drying services can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Fresno, TX. Our prices are competitive and transparent, with estimates provided upfront so you know exactly what to expect. Get a free estimate today and let us help you get your property back to normal.

ServiceTypical Price RangeWhat Affects Cost
Water Extraction and Drying$500 – $2,500Size of affected area, severity of damage, and local conditions
Demolition and Repair$1,000 – $5,000Size of affected area, severity of damage, and materials required
Final Inspection and Cleaning$200 – $1,000Size of affected area, severity of damage, and materials required
Structural Drying Services (total)$2,000 – $10,000Size of affected area, severity of damage, and local conditions
